Transaction 1ab94ae6218494a75ab37f00d245edad654f4e2cf92c7ec9d2bb4cd2b8764666
1 Input
1 Output
-
1ab94ae6218494a75ab37f00d245edad654f4e2cf92c7ec9d2bb4cd2b8764666:0
- value
- 76969
- script pubkey
- OP_0 OP_PUSHBYTES_20 268d1b87602144c6786603ebb404e0bfbe1f02e8
- address
- bc1qy6x3hpmqy9zvv7rxq04mgp8qh7lp7qhgzkjv4n